Transaction cdccbc51cd9bc7c5a073bbe780144f0cdf66bbbb4e0a84c12bb3e111a141e84f

block
32ac240213ac4e8eeb06b237445fe5e5828e38756428cad176009bafe7cda49f

1 Input

23 Outputs